Not a "one off" per se but the design may get a slight tweak if there are anymore.

Specs:

5/32 CPM154
Overall is 4 1/4 inches
Cutting edge is 1 5/8ths inches

Green canvas scales, phenolic pin and SS lanyard tube

Bead blast finish all over.

Kydex pocket/neck sheath

Price is $100 plus FREE shipping(tracked/insure Canada/US) Int'l not tracked
